It also doesn't mention that you don't need to register for VAT until you have a turnover of £82k.

But for coders it's almost always worth registering straight away and going for the FRS.

Also, on FRS you can claim a single £2k expense annually.

Within the EU. For example if you have a turnover of £100k all from outside of the EU you don't need to register.
You don't have to,but you might want to - if you want to do any business with EU companies you have to give them your VAT number to be properly paid and invoiced. My company doesn't make anywhere near 82k,but it has to be VAT-registered for this very reason.
